Philadelphia Commercial Lucky Break Carpet Tile delivers long-lasting performance, modern style, and sustainable innovation for busy commercial environments.

Designed with Level Loop construction and EcoSolution Q100® Nylon, it stands up to heavy foot traffic without sacrificing visual appeal.

Its solution-dyed fiber and SSP Protective Treatments resist stains and fading, keeping floors looking newer for longer.

EcoWorx® backing provides dimensional stability, moisture resistance, and supports your sustainability goals.

Easy to install and replace, it supports LEED credits and comes with a Lifetime Commercial Limited Warranty—ideal for offices, retail, hospitality, and education.

Color Disclaimer

While online swatches and showroom visits are great for initial exploration, nailing the perfect flooring color requires a closer look. To guarantee your satisfaction, we highly recommend ordering a sample directly from us or the manufacturer.

Even with samples, keep in mind that they might not be an exact replica of the final product due to slight variations in production runs. This means the shade could differ slightly if the materials were made at different times.

If you're installing the flooring in a single, large space, like a living room or hallway, it's crucial to be extra cautious. Slight shade variations between production batches can become noticeable when laid out together.

To ensure a seamless look, we recommend purchasing enough flooring to cover the entire space, plus an additional 10% for waste. This buffer allows you to select pieces from the same production batch, minimizing the risk of color inconsistencies.
